Does the 2016 M235i (F23) exhaust have a valve that give it the dual outlet in Sport and sport + mode?

For M235i stock exhaust, that is an anti drone valve. I know other bmw models use this setup too, and not sure if it's identical on the Mperf muffler. It closes in certain situations to prevent excess cabin NVH when the engine speed drops below 1500rpm-ish, I'm guessing because the ZF8 in D constantly wants to be between 1100-1500. Others have reported it being open as well as shut in different modes, as well as open and shut sometimes on startup. Seemed inconclusive, but none of that info really concerns me because the idea of a PCM controlled valve is sacrilege to me. FWIW, there's not much increase in drone with it open in all driving situations. Most noticeable on cold start, for a brief 10-15 seconds

I removed the spring that connects motor to valve, then ended up tack welding the valve in the open position. I tried JB weld a couple times at first, but it vibrated loose each time and made a racket. I welded it in a way where I can break it off later and return to normal function if needed.
